Gland Pharma has received an order from the Deputy Commissioner (ST)-V, GST Department, Telangana, raising a tax demand of ₹5.03 crore along with interest and a penalty of ₹1.26 crore, taking the total disputed amount to roughly ₹6.29 crore (plus interest) for FY 2019-20. The GST authority has treated some export turnover as local sales (₹4.58 crore) and flagged certain credit notes related to exports (₹45.72 lakh) as taxable. The company disagrees with the order, plans to file an appeal with the appellate authority, and has stated that there is no material impact on its financials, operations, or other activities.
The disputed amount is small relative to Gland Pharma's overall size, and the company will appeal, so the near-term impact on the stock is likely limited. Investors should watch the appeal outcome, as a final adverse ruling could result in an actual cash outflow of around ₹6.29 crore plus interest.
